Hanty-Mansijsk vs Kowloon, Hong Kong Climate & Distance Between

Hong Kong flag
  • The distance between Hanty-Mansijsk, Russia and Kowloon, Hong Kong, Hong Kong is approximately 5,511 km or 3,425 mi.
  • To reach Hanty-Mansijsk in this distance one would set out from Kowloon, Hong Kong bearing 333.2°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Hanty-Mansijsk bearing 300.6° or WNW .
  • Hanty-Mansijsk has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c) whereas Kowloon, Hong Kong has a humid subtropical climate with dry winters (Cwa).
  • The average annual temperature is 24.6 °C (44.2°F) cooler.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 25.8 °C (46.4°F) more in Hanty-Mansijsk.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to truly oceanic.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 1666.8 mm (65.6 in) less which is equivalent to 1666.8 l/m² (40.91 US gal/ft²) or 16,668,000 l/ha (1,781,920 US gal/ac) less. About 1/4 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 38.4° lower in Hanty-Mansijsk than in Kowloon, Hong Kong.
